智能对话系统的安全性与隐私保护技术解析

在信息化、数字化时代,人工智能技术飞速发展,智能对话系统作为一种新型人机交互方式,逐渐走进了我们的生活。然而,随着智能对话系统的广泛应用,其安全性与隐私保护问题也日益凸显。本文将从技术角度对智能对话系统的安全性与隐私保护进行解析,以期为广大开发者、使用者提供参考。

一、智能对话系统概述

智能对话系统是指通过自然语言处理、知识图谱、语音识别等技术,实现人与机器之间自然、流畅的交互。它具有以下特点:

  1. 自然性:智能对话系统能够理解用户的需求,并以自然、流畅的语言进行回答。

  2. 个性化:根据用户的历史行为、兴趣等,智能对话系统可以提供个性化的服务。

  3. 智能化:通过不断学习和优化,智能对话系统能够提高对话的准确性和效率。

二、智能对话系统的安全性问题

  1. 信息泄露:在智能对话过程中,用户可能会透露个人隐私信息,如身份证号、银行卡号等。若系统存在安全漏洞,这些信息可能被恶意攻击者窃取。

  2. 系统被篡改:黑客可能通过恶意代码攻击,篡改智能对话系统,使其提供错误的信息,甚至危害用户利益。

  3. 逆向工程:通过逆向工程,攻击者可以了解智能对话系统的内部结构,从而找到系统漏洞,进行攻击。

  4. 系统被恶意利用:黑客可能利用智能对话系统进行钓鱼、诈骗等恶意活动。

三、智能对话系统的隐私保护技术

  1. 加密技术:对用户数据进行加密,确保数据在传输和存储过程中的安全性。常用的加密算法有AES、RSA等。

  2. 安全认证技术:采用双因素认证、多因素认证等技术,确保用户身份的合法性。例如,使用手机短信验证码、指纹识别等。

  3. 访问控制技术:根据用户角色、权限,对系统资源进行访问控制,防止非法访问。

  4. 安全审计技术:对系统操作进行审计,记录用户行为,以便在发生安全事件时追溯。

  5. 异常检测技术:通过监测系统运行状态,发现异常行为,及时采取措施,防止安全事件发生。

四、案例分析

以某知名智能对话系统为例,该系统在安全性方面采取了以下措施:

  1. 采用AES加密算法对用户数据进行加密,确保数据传输和存储安全。

  2. 采用双因素认证,要求用户在登录时输入密码和短信验证码,提高账户安全性。

  3. 对系统操作进行审计,记录用户行为,以便在发生安全事件时追溯。

  4. 部署安全审计系统,实时监测系统运行状态,发现异常行为。

五、总结

智能对话系统的安全性与隐私保护是当前亟待解决的问题。通过采用加密、安全认证、访问控制、安全审计等技术在技术层面进行保障,可以有效降低安全风险。然而,在现实应用中,还需要从法律、政策等方面进行完善,共同维护智能对话系统的安全与隐私。

猜你喜欢:AI机器人